How they compare

Poland currently reports 0.0397 units per person against 0.0329 units per person in OECD members, a difference of 0.0068 units per person.

That makes Poland's figure about 1.2 times OECD members's.

The two have swapped places 6 times across 66 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Poland ahead.

OECD members ranks 12th and Poland ranks 12th of 43 groups.

Across the 7 decades both report, OECD members averaged higher in 2 and Poland in 5.
